RESUMO

Metallic materials characterization is a important part of phase transformation studies, and the sample preparation plays a crucial role in the measured properties. The methodologies available are not fully described and refer in its majority only to iron-based and aluminum-based alloys focusing in industrial analysis. In this paper the authors fully described the preparation methodology for metallic samples used by their research group. This method aims to attend different characterization techniques, producing samples of complex metallic systems from pure base materials by arc melting. •The melting of metallic ingots from pure base materials was fully described.•The correct sample cutting, sanding and polishing procedures were described.•A full detailed procedure is described to prepare the samples for different analyses.

RESUMO

BACKGROUND AND PURPOSE: The level of cell surface expression of the meningococcal vaccine antigen, Factor H binding protein (FHbp) varies between and within strains and this limits the breadth of strains that can be targeted by FHbp-based vaccines. The molecular pathway controlling expression of FHbp at the cell surface, including its lipidation, sorting to the outer membrane and export, and the potential regulation of this pathway have not been investigated until now. This knowledge will aid our evaluation of FHbp vaccines. EXPERIMENTAL APPROACH: A meningococcal transposon library was screened by whole cell immuno-dot blotting using an anti-FHbp antibody to identify a mutant with reduced binding and the disrupted gene was determined. KEY RESULTS: In a mutant with markedly reduced binding, the transposon was located in the lnt gene which encodes apolipoprotein N-acyl transferase, Lnt, responsible for the addition of the third fatty acid to apolipoproteins prior to their sorting to the outer membrane. We provide data indicating that in the Lnt mutant, FHbp is diacylated and its expression within the cell is reduced 10 fold, partly due to inhibition of transcription. Furthermore the Lnt mutant showed 64 fold and 16 fold increase in susceptibility to rifampicin and ciprofloxacin respectively. CONCLUSION AND IMPLICATIONS: We speculate that the inefficient sorting of diacylated FHbp in the meningococcus results in its accumulation in the periplasm inducing an envelope stress response to down-regulate its expression. We propose Lnt as a potential novel drug target for combination therapy with antibiotics. RESUMO

Infrared (IR) and vibrational circular dichroism (VCD) spectra were measured for a series of isotopically ((13)C on two or more amide Cdouble bond]O) labeled, 25 residue, alpha-helical peptides of the sequence Ac-(AAAAK)(4)AAAAY-NH(2) that were also studied in the previous paper. Theoretical IR and VCD simulations were performed for correspondingly isotopically labeled Ac-A(24)-NHCH(3) constrained to an alpha-helical conformation by use of property tensor transfer from density functional theory (DFT) calculations on Ac-A(10)-NHCH(3). The simulations predicted and experiments confirmed that the vibrational coupling constants between i, i + 1 and i, i + 2 residues differ in sign, thus leading to a reversal of the (13)C VCD pattern and explaining the large shift in the (13)C amide I frequency as reported in the previous paper. The sign of the coupling constant remained consistent for larger label separation (with the exception of i, i + 4) and for more labels with uniform separation. Such effects confirm that the isotopically labeled group vibrations are essentially only coupled to each other and are effectively uncoupled from those of the unlabeled groups. This development confirms the utility of isotopic labels for site-specific structural studies with vibrational spectra. Observed spectral effects cannot be explained by considering only transition dipole coupling (TDC) between amide oscillators, particularly for smaller label separations, but the TDC and ab initio predicted couplings roughly converge at large separation.

RESUMO

Empregando-se métodos físico-químicos oficiais foram determinadas algumas características do leite fluido consumido em Belém, Estado do Pará, observando-se flagrantes irregularidades nos três tipos de apresentaçäo do produto em relaçäo aos padröes regulamentares. No leite cru, 24 (39,4 por cento) amostras apresentaram densidade abaixo do limite regulamentar, 10 (15,9 por cento) e 34 (54,0 por cento) amostras tinham acidez titulável respectivamente abaixo e acima da faixa regulamentar, 17 (42,5 por cento) mostraram instabilidade frente ao álcool-alizarol, 31 (83,8 por cento) apresentavam sujidades, seis (9,8 por cento) continham peróxido de hidrogênio e 21 (32,3 por cento) foram classificadas como de péssima qualidade na prova da redutase. O leite pasteurizado reconstituído com 3 por cento de gordura apresentou 23 (95,8 por cento) amostras com densidade abaixo do limite regulamentar, 19 (67,9 por cento) e três (10,7 por cento) com acidez titulável respectivamente abaixo e acima do limite regulamentar, cinco (16,1 por cento) continham peróxido de hidrogênio e 25 (86,2 por cento) mostraram superaquecimento no teste de peroxidase. No leite pasteurizado tipo "C", duas (33,3 por cento) amostras tinham acidez titulável acima do limite regulamentar e 100 por cento delas mostraram superaquecimento no teste de peroxidase
